Program Description

Statistics and Computing combines number skills with computer tools to help businesses make smart decisions. You will study statistics, probability, data analysis, spreadsheets, basic programming, and business subjects like marketing and finance. Classes include practical projects where you collect, clean, analyze, and present data to solve real business problems. Graduates can work as business managers, marketing specialists, human resources officers, financial analysts, or start their own businesses. This program builds analytical thinking, digital skills, and leadership abilities that are in demand in Ghana and beyond. If you enjoy numbers, problem solving, and using technology to improve business operations, this program can open many practical and well paid career paths.

Aims & Objectives

1

Develop the ability to collect, clean, and analyze business data using spreadsheets and one statistical software, demonstrated through practical assignments.

2

Master core statistical methods, including descriptive statistics and basic inferential tests, and interpret results to support marketing and finance decisions.

3

Understand business operations and leadership principles, and apply data-driven solutions in at least two case study projects.

4

Create clear data visualizations and professional reports for decision makers, completing a portfolio of presentations and dashboards.

Skills & Tools

Skills You'll Develop

Use formulas, pivot tables, lookup functions, and basic macros to clean data, build budgets, and run business models.

Write simple scripts to analyze datasets, run statistical tests, and automate repetitive data tasks.

Design interactive charts and dashboards to communicate insights to managers and customers.

Build cashflow forecasts, simple financial models, and budget reports to support decision making.

Tools & Resources

Microsoft Excel (Office 365 or similar)

Python with pandas or R for statistical analysis

Power BI or Tableau for data visualization

SPSS or similar for introductory statistical work
